The form should have strict validation code. Electoral IDs are a certain length, other fields might also have patterns that can be enforced.
It is very important to have the correct entries in the system, this is the base of the counting process which guides the strategy. Wrong entries are costly not only in the lost signature, but the erroneous information it provides to decision makers.
The formal submission is in the form of an official document with the list of all the signatures, their personal information, the signatures in ink, and attached the pictures in the same order.
An potentially good assumption is that the order in those forms will be in the same as the timestamp of the entries in the DB.

It is possible that the timestamp will not be perfect match for the forms, or that one person will not be able to print pictures for everyone, so the service should be able to provide the pictures given an order of IFE card_ids
The official submission is a long form with the voter information and the ink signatures in it and attached the corresponding, two-sided pictures of the electoral card. The voter should be able to print this form at all times.
The forms should have a unique identifier somewhere in the page. This identifier should be a field in the form submitted by the application.
Mexico has until now 4 types of electoral cards, they each have a manual way to check whether they are valid for the upcoming election. There is also a way online to find whether a specific card is valid, but it is under a CAPTCHA protectibon.
